Port strike union chief Harold Daggett: What to know

Worldwide Longshoreman’s Affiliation (ILA) President Harold Daggett has jumped into the nationwide highlight as he heads up negotiations for the union in its strike at ports throughout the U.S.

The ILA launched its first strike since 1977 early Tuesday with Daggett main the cost after the union’s six-year contract with the U.S. Maritime Alliance (USMX), which represents port employers, expired.

Harold Daggett, president of the Worldwide Longshoremen’s Affiliation (ILA), middle, speaks to picketing staff outdoors the APM container terminal on the Port of Newark in Newark, New Jersey, US, on Tuesday, Oct. 1, 2024. (Michael Nagle/Bloomberg by way of Getty Pictures / Getty Pictures)

Based on Daggett’s biography on the ALI web site, he was first elected president of the union in 2011, and is at present serving in his fourth four-year time period on the helm after working greater than 60 years within the trade. The write-up credit him with profitable “groundbreaking protections for his ILA members against the ravishes of automation” over the previous decade.

Daggett additionally served as president of Native 1804-1 for 14 years, stepping down in 2011 when he was named President Emeritus of the native. The ALI bio notes that the union honored Daggett by erecting a statue of him outdoors 1804-1’s North Bergen, New Jersey, headquarters in 2023.

Union filings from the Division of Labor point out Daggett was paid a $728,000 wage by the ALI final 12 months, and one other $173,000 from 1804-1. 

Daggett’s oldest son, Dennis Daggett, at present serves as the chief vp of the ILA and as president of 1804-1. Dennis was paid salaries of $388,000 and $314,000, respectively, by the labor teams final 12 months, filings present.

In 2017, The New York Instances reported that “the Justice Department, which has lost two cases against [Harold] Daggett, has described him as an ‘associate’ of the Genovese crime family whose rise through the union ranks was part of the mob’s plan.”

The Instances additionally famous that, on the time, the ILA president owned a 76-foot yacht, the Obsession, and Daggett had been seen using in a Bentley by members.
